免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发细则

App开发细则是指在进行移动应用程序开发时需要遵循的一系列原则和规范。本文将从原理和详细介绍两个方面来介绍App开发细则。

一、原理介绍

1.需求分析:在开始开发前,需进行充分的需求分析,确定App的功能、用户群体、平台等,为后续的设计和开发提供指导。

2.用户体验:用户体验是App开发的核心,需要关注界面设计、交互设计、流畅性等方面,确保用户能够愉快地使用App。

3.平台适配:根据目标用户的设备平台选择相应的开发技术和工具,确保App在不同平台上的兼容性和稳定性。

4.安全性:保护用户隐私和数据安全是开发App时必须考虑的重要因素,需要加密用户数据、防止恶意攻击等。

5.性能优化:通过代码优化、资源管理、网络请求等手段提高App的运行效率和响应速度,提升用户体验。

二、详细介绍

1.项目规划:在开始开发前,制定详细的项目计划,包括开发周期、人员分工、技术选型等,确保开发进度和质量。

2.架构设计:根据需求分析和功能模块划分,设计App的整体架构,确定各个模块之间的关系和交互方式。

3.界面设计:根据用户体验原则和平台规范,设计App的界面布局、颜色搭配、图标等,使界面简洁、直观、美观。

4.代码编写:根据架构设计和界面设计,编写高质量的代码,注重代码的可读性、可维护性和可扩展性。

5.测试与调试:进行功能测试、性能测试、兼容性测试等,及时发现和修复问题,确保App的稳定性和质量。

6.发布与上线:在测试完成后,将App发布到相应的应用商店或平台上,进行上线运营,并及时收集用户反馈进行优化。

总结:

App开发细则是一系列规范和原则的集合,通过遵循这些细则,可以提高App的质量、用户体验和安全性。在开发过程中,需要进行需求分析、用户体验设计、平台适配、安全保护、性能优化等工作。同时,还需要制定详细的项目计划、设计合理的架构、精心设计界面、编写高质量的代码、进行全面的测试和及时发布上线。通过遵循App开发细则,可以帮助开发者更好地开发出优秀的移动应用程序。


相关知识:
app手机软件用什么开发的
手机软件的开发可以使用多种不同的技术和工具,以满足不同的需求和目标。下面我来详细介绍一下手机软件开发的原理和步骤。手机软件的开发一般分为前端开发和后端开发两个部分。前端开发主要负责用户界面的设计和开发,而后端开发主要负责软件的逻辑和数据处理。1. 前端开发
2023-07-14
app开发中遇到的逻辑问题
在app开发过程中,经常会遇到各种逻辑问题。这些问题可能涉及到数据处理、用户交互、界面设计等方面。下面我将介绍一些常见的逻辑问题,并提供相应的解决方案。1. 数据处理问题:在app中,我们经常需要对数据进行处理,如排序、过滤、计算等。一个常见的问题是如何高
2023-06-29
app开发拉新活动方案怎么做
随着智能手机的普及,各种应用软件的用户数量迅速增加。而对于应用开发者来说,吸引用户下载使用自己的应用程序,是他们最为重要的任务之一。因此,针对App开发的拉新活动方案便应运而生。下面将为大家介绍一下App开发拉新活动方案的原理和详细步骤。一、App开发拉新
2023-06-29
app的建设开发
应用程序,简称 app,是指为特定的使用需求而开发的一款在移动设备上运行的应用软件。在移动互联网时代,app已经成为人们日常生活中必不可少的一个工具。开发一款 app 需要了解一定的技术知识和方法,下面将介绍 app 开发的原理和详细步骤。一、app 开发
2023-05-06
app滑动图案开发
App滑动图案是现在很多应用程序登录和安全认证的一种常用方式。因为图案的规律性和复杂性,很难被破解,同时又比密码更容易记忆,所以非常流行。在本文中,我们将探讨App滑动图案的原理以及它的开发过程。在开发过程中,我们可以采用以下步骤来实现滑动图案功能:第一步
2023-05-06
app混合开发vue
App混合开发是指在一个App中嵌入一个WebView,通过WebView来展示网页,并在网页中通过JavaScript和Native交互,实现一些Native不能实现的功能,比如推送、分享、支付等。Vue.js是目前较为流行的前端框架之一,在App混合开
2023-05-06